2 more results for Auto repair in Metairie, Louisiana
Metairie, Louisiana, United States
From our convenient Metairie, LA location, Complete Automotive Repair Services has been providing high-quality automotive repair and maintenance to the Greater New Orleans Metro area for over 12 years. With a comprehensive, 41-point Courtesy Inspection Sheet, our team of ASE-certified technicians ca…
Metairie, Louisiana, United States
Towing in Metairie, LA…
- Verified
- Products (4)
- Website
- Phone